Print this page
12595 restructure digest crypto-tests
Reviewed by: Jason King <jason.king@joyent.com>
Reviewed by: Toomas Soome <tsoome@me.com>
Change-Id: Id850230fe9e9e0ee9eb39066b3c07e25739866f8

@@ -9,22 +9,27 @@
 # http://www.illumos.org/license/CDDL.
 #
 
 #
 # Copyright 2019 Joyent, Inc.
+# Copyright 2020 Oxide Computer Company
 #
 
 ALGS    = sha1 sha256 sha384 sha512 sha512_224 sha512_256 md5
+SUBDIRS = data
 
 all     :=      TARGET = all
 install :=      TARGET = install
 clean   :=      TARGET = clean
 clobber :=      TARGET = clobber
 
 .KEEP_STATE:
 
-all clean clobber install: $(ALGS)
+all clean clobber install: $(ALGS) $(SUBDIRS)
 
 $(ALGS): FRC
         $(MAKE) -e -f Makefile.digest BASEPROG=$@ $(TARGET)
 
+$(SUBDIRS): FRC
+        cd $@; pwd; $(MAKE) $(TARGET)
+
 FRC: